Spanish Court Backs Extradition of Russian Programmer to US

Spain’s National Court has recommended the extradition to the United States of a Russian computer programmer accused by U.S. prosecutors of developing malicious software that stole information from financial institutions and caused losses of $855,000.

Stanislav Lisov, 31, was arrested January 13 in the Barcelona Airport while on honeymoon in Europe. Prosecutors accuse him of developing the NeverQuest software that targeted banking clients in the United States between June 2012 and January 2015.

The Spanish court said Tuesday that Lisov could face up to 25 years in prison for conspiracy to commit electronic and computer fraud. The extradition hearing took place July 20.

The court said its ruling can be appealed by Lisov.

The extradition, if finally decided upon, must be approved by the government.

US Senators to Introduce Bill to Secure ‘Internet of Things’

A bipartisan group of U.S. senators on Tuesday plans to introduce legislation seeking to address vulnerabilities in computing devices embedded in everyday objects — known in the tech industry as the “internet of things” — which experts have long warned poses a threat to global cyber security.

The new bill would require vendors that provide internet-connected equipment to the U.S. government to ensure their products are patchable and conform to industry security standards. It would also prohibit vendors from supplying devices that have unchangeable passwords or possess known security vulnerabilities.

Republicans Cory Gardner and Steve Daines and Democrats Mark Warner and Ron Wyden are sponsoring the legislation, which was drafted with input from technology experts at the Atlantic Council and Harvard University. A Senate aide who helped write the bill said that companion legislation in the House was expected soon.

“We’re trying to take the lightest touch possible,” Warner told Reuters in an interview. He added that the legislation was intended to remedy an “obvious market failure” that has left device manufacturers with little incentive to build with security in mind.

The legislation would allow federal agencies to ask the U.S. Office of Management and Budget for permission to buy some non-compliant devices if other controls, such as network segmentation, are in place.

It would also expand legal protections for cyber researchers working in “good faith” to hack equipment to find vulnerabilities so manufacturers can patch previously unknown flaws.

Security researchers have long said that the ballooning array of online devices including cars, household appliances, speakers and medical equipment are not adequately protected from hackers who might attempt to steal personal information or launch sophisticated cyber attacks.

Between 20 billion and 30 billion devices are expected to be connected to the internet by 2020, researchers estimate, with a large percentage of them insecure.

Though security for the internet of things has been a known problem for years, some manufacturers say they are not well equipped to produce cyber secure devices.

Hundreds of thousands of insecure webcams, digital records and other everyday devices were hijacked last October to support a major attack on internet infrastructure that temporarily knocked some web services offline, including Twitter, PayPal and Spotify.

The new legislation includes “reasonable security recommendations” that would be important to improve protection of federal government networks, said Ray O’Farrell, chief technology officer at cloud computing firm VMware.

Germany Tests Facial Recognition Technology at Rail Station

German authorities have launched a six-month test of automatic facial recognition technology at a Berlin railway station, which the country’s top security official says could be used to improve security in the future.

More than 200 people volunteered to have their names and two photos stored for the project at Suedkreuz station, where three cameras film an entrance and an escalator.

Interior Minister Thomas de Maiziere said in a statement Tuesday “technical progress must not stop at our security services.”

But Germans generally back strong data protection. Ulrich Schellenberg, head of the German Bar Association, said “not everything that is technically possible is something we want to do as a society.”

It’s not clear how officials will proceed after the test.

Deputy PM: Luxembourg’s Space Mining Mission Begins Tuesday

When Luxembourg’s new law governing space mining comes into force on Tuesday, the country will already be working to make the science-fiction-sounding mission a reality, the deputy prime minister said.

The legislation will make Luxembourg the first country in Europe to offer a legal framework to ensure that private operators can be confident about their rights over resources they extract in space.

The law is based on the premise that space resources are capable of being owned by individuals and private companies and establishes the procedures for authorizing and supervising space exploration missions.

“When I launched the initiative a year ago, people thought I was mad,” Etienne Schneider told Reuters.

“But for us, we see it as a business that has return on investment in the short-term, the medium-term, and the long-term,” said Schneider, who is also Luxembourg’s economy minister.

Luxembourg in June 2016 set aside 200 million euros ($229 million) to fund initiatives aimed at bringing back rare minerals from space.

While that goal is at least 15 years off, new technologies are already creating markets that space mining could supply, said Schneider.

He said firms could soon make carrying materials to refuel or repair satellites economically feasible or supply raw materials to the 3-D printers now being tested on the International Space Station.

Lifting each kilogram of mass from Earth to orbit costs between 10,000 and 15,000 euros ($11,000 to $18,000), according to Schneider, but firms could cut these costs by recycling the debris of old satellites and rocket parts floating in space.

The small European country, best known for its fund management and private banking sector, will on Tuesday begin the work of making such deals, with the security of a legal framework in place, said Schneider.

Luxembourg has already managed to attract significant interest from pioneers in the field such as U.S. operators Planetary Resources and Deep Space Industries, and aims to attract research and development projects to set up there.

A similar package of laws was introduced in the United States in 2015 but only applies to companies majority owned by Americans, while Luxembourg’s laws will only require the company to have an office in the country.

“I am already in discussions with fund owners for more than 1 billion euros which they want to dedicate to space exploration over here in Luxembourg,” Schneider said. “In 10 years, I’m quite sure that the official language in space will be Luxembourgish.”

Mainstream Model 3 Could Make or Break Tesla Dreams

For Tesla, everything is riding on the Model 3.

The electric car company’s newest vehicle was delivered to its first 30 customers, all Tesla employees, Friday evening. Its $35,000 starting price, half the cost of Tesla’s previous models, and range of up to 310 miles (498 km) could bring hundreds of thousands of customers into the automaker’s fold, taking it from a niche luxury brand to the mainstream. Around 500,000 people worldwide have reserved a Model 3.

Those higher sales could finally make Tesla profitable and accelerate its plans for future products like SUVs and pickups.

Or the Model 3 could dash Tesla’s dreams.

Much could go wrong

Potential customers could lose faith if Tesla doesn’t meet its aggressive production schedule, or if the cars have quality problems that strain Tesla’s small service network. 

The compact Model 3 may not entice a global market that’s increasingly shifting to SUVs, including all-electric SUVs from Audi and others going on sale soon. And a fully loaded Model 3 with 310 miles of range costs a hefty $59,500; the base model goes 220 miles (322 km) on a charge.

Limits on the $7,500 U.S. tax credit for electric cars could also hurt demand. Once an automaker sells 200,000 electric cars in the U.S., the credit phases out. Tesla has sold more than 126,000 vehicles since 2008, according to estimates by WardsAuto, so not everyone who buys a Model 3 will be eligible.

“There are more reasons to think that it won’t be successful than it will,” says Karl Brauer, the executive publisher for Cox Automotive, which owns Autotrader and other car buying sites.

Always part of Tesla plans

The Model 3 has long been part of Palo Alto, California-based Tesla’s plans. In 2006, three years after the company was founded, CEO Elon Musk said Tesla would eventually build “affordably priced family cars” after establishing itself with high-end vehicles like the Model S, which starts at $69,500. This will be the first time many Tesla workers will be able to afford a Tesla.

“It was never our goal to make expensive cars. We wanted to make a car everyone could buy,” Musk said Friday. “If you’re trying to make a difference in the world, you also need to make cars people can afford.”

Tesla started taking reservations for the Model 3 in March 2016. Musk said more than 500,000 people have put down a $1,000 deposit for the car. People ordering a car now likely won’t get it until late 2018. Cars will go first to employees and customers on the West Coast; overseas deliveries start late next year, and right-hand drive versions come in 2019.

Challenges to deliver

But carmaking has proved a challenge to Musk. Both the Model S and the Model X SUV were delayed and then plagued with pesky problems, like doors that don’t work and blank screens in their high-tech dashboards.

Tesla’s luxury car owners might overlook those problems because they liked the thrill of being early adopters. But mainstream buyers will be less forgiving.

“This will be their primary vehicle, so they will have high expectations of quality and durability and expect everything to work every time,” said Sam Abuelsamid, a senior researcher with Navigant Research.

The Model 3 was designed to be much simpler and cheaper to make than Tesla’s previous vehicles. It has one dashboard screen, not two, and no fancy door handles. It’s made primarily of steel, not aluminum. It has no instrument panel; the speed limit and other information normally there can be found on the center screen. It doesn’t even have a key fob; drivers can open and lock the car with a smartphone or a credit cardlike key.

‘Manufacturing hell’

Still, Musk said he’s expecting “at least six months of manufacturing hell” as the Model 3 ramps up to full production. Musk wants to be making 20,000 Model 3s per month by December at the carmaker’s Fremont factory.

Musk aims to make 500,000 vehicles next year, a number that could help Tesla finally make money. The company has only had two profitable quarters since it went public in 2010. But even at that pace, Tesla will remain a small player. Toyota Motor Corp. made more than 10 million vehicles last year.

Abuelsamid said even if it doesn’t meet its ambitious targets, Tesla has done more than anyone to promote electric vehicles.

“A decade ago they were a little more than golf carts. Now all of a sudden, EVs are real, practical vehicles that can be used for anything,” he said.

Hackers Scour Voting Machines for Election Bugs

Hackers attending this weekend’s Def Con hacking convention in Las Vegas were invited to break into voting machines and voter databases in a bid to uncover vulnerabilities that could be exploited to sway election results.

The 25-year-old conference’s first “hacker voting village” opened on Friday as part of an effort to raise awareness about the threat of election results being altered through hacking.

Hackers crammed into a crowded conference room for the rare opportunity to examine and attempt to hack some 30 pieces of election equipment, much of it purchased over eBay, including some voting machines and digital voter registries that are currently in use.

Showdown between hackers

“We encourage you to do stuff that if you did on election day they would probably arrest you,” said Johns Hopkins computer scientist Matt Blaze, who organized the segment in a conference room at the Caesar’s Palace convention center.

The exercise featured a “cyber range” simulator where blue teams were tasked with defending a mock local election system from red team hackers.

Concerns about election hacking have surged since U.S. intelligence agencies claimed that Russian President Vladimir Putin ordered the hacking of Democratic Party emails to help Republican Donald Trump win the 2016 U.S. presidential election.

Russians targeted 21 state elections

A Department of Homeland Security official told Congress in June that Russian hackers had targeted 21 U.S. state election systems in the 2016 presidential race and a small number were breached, but there was no evidence that any votes had been manipulated.

Russia has denied the accusations.

Jake Braun, another organizer, said he believed the hacker voting village would convince participants that hacking could be used to sway an election.

“There’s been a lot of claims that our election system is unhackable. That’s BS,” said Braun. “Only a fool or liar would try to claim that their database or machine was unhackable.”

Call for paper ballots

Barbara Simons, president of advocacy group Verified Voting, said she expects Russia to try to influence the U.S. 2018 midterm election and 2020 elections. To counter such threats, she called for requiring use of paper ballots and mandatory auditing computers to count them.

More than 20,000 people were expected to attend the three-day Def Con convention.

The hacker voting village was one of about a dozen interactive areas where participants could study and practice hacking in fields such as automobiles, cryptology and healthcare.

 

Honolulu Targets ‘Smartphone Zombies’ With Crosswalk Ban

A ban on pedestrians looking at mobile phones or texting while crossing the street will take effect in Hawaii’s largest city in late October, as Honolulu becomes the first major U.S. city to pass legislation aimed at reducing injuries and deaths from “distracted walking.”

The ban comes as cities around the world grapple with how to protect “smartphone zombies” from injuring themselves by stepping into traffic or running into stationary objects.

Starting October 25, a Honolulu pedestrian can be fined between $15 and $99, depending on the number of times police catch him looking at a phone or tablet device as he crosses a street, Mayor Kirk Caldwell told reporters gathered near one of the city’s busiest downtown intersections Thursday.

“We hold the unfortunate distinction of being a major city with more pedestrians being hit in crosswalks, particularly our seniors, than almost any other city in the county,” Caldwell said. Honolulu data on distracted-walking incidents were not immediately available.

Caldwell signed the legislation Thursday after it was passed in a 7-2 vote by the City Council earlier this month, city records show.

People making calls for emergency services are exempt from the ban.

Injury toll

More than 11,000 injuries resulted from phone-related distraction while walking in the United States between 2000 and 2011, according to a University of Maryland study published in 2015.

The findings pushed the nonprofit National Safety Council to add “distracted walking” to its annual compilation of the biggest risks for unintentional injuries and deaths in the United States, highlighting the severity of the issue.

“Cellphones are not just pervading our roadways but pervading our sidewalks, too,” Maureen Vogel, a spokeswoman for the council, said in a phone interview on Friday.

Efforts to save pedestrians from their phones extend beyond America’s shores. London has experimented with padding lamp posts to soften the blow for distracted walkers, according to the Independent newspaper.

In Germany, the city of Augsburg last year embedded traffic signals into the ground near tram tracks to help downward-fixated pedestrians avoid injury, local media reported.

Opponents of the Honolulu law argued it infringes on personal freedom and amounts to government overreach.

“Scrap this intrusive bill, provide more education to citizens about responsible electronics usage, and allow law enforcement to focus on larger issues,” resident Ben Robinson told the City Council in written testimony.

Roomba Vacuum Maker iRobot Betting Big on ‘Smart’ Home

The Roomba robotic vacuum has been whizzing across floors for years, but its future may lie more in collecting data than dirt.

That data is of the spatial variety: the dimensions of a room as well as distances between sofas, tables, lamps and other home furnishings. To a tech industry eager to push “smart” homes controlled by a variety of Internet-enabled devices, that space is the next frontier.

Smart home lighting, thermostats and security cameras are already on the market, but Colin Angle, chief executive of Roomba maker iRobot Corp., says they are still dumb when it comes to understanding their physical environment. He thinks the mapping technology currently guiding top-end Roomba models could change that and is basing the company’s strategy on it.

“There’s an entire ecosystem of things and services that the smart home can deliver once you have a rich map of the home that the user has allowed to be shared,” said Angle.

That vision has its fans, from investors to the likes of Amazon.com, Apple and Alphabet, who are all pushing artificially intelligent voice assistants as smart home interfaces. According to financial research firm IHS Markit, the market for smart home devices was worth $9.8 billion in 2016 and is projected to grow 60 percent this year.

Map sharing

Angle told Reuters that iRobot, which made Roomba compatible with Amazon’s Alexa voice assistant in March, could reach a deal to share its maps for free with customer consent to one or more of the Big Three in the next couple of years. Angle added the company could extract value from those agreements by connecting for free with as many companies as possible to make the device more useful in the home.

Amazon declined to comment, and Apple and Google did not respond to requests for comment.

So far investors have cheered Angle’s plans, sending iRobot stock soaring to $102 in mid-June from $35 a year ago, giving it a market value of nearly $2.5 billion on 2016 revenue of $660 million.

But there are headwinds for iRobot’s approach, ranging from privacy concerns to a rising group of mostly cheaper competitors — such as the $300 Bissell SmartClean and the $270 Hoover Quest 600 — which are threatening to turn a once-futuristic product into a commoditized home appliance.

Low-cost Roomba rivals were the subject of a report by short-seller Ben Axler of Spruce Point Capital Management, which sent the stock down 20 percent to $84 at the end of June.

The company’s smart home vision has helped bring around some former critics. Willem Mesdag, managing partner of hedge fund Red Mountain Capital — who led an unsuccessful proxy fight against Angle last year and wound up selling his iRobot shares — is now largely supportive of the company’s direction.

“I think they have a tremendous first-mover advantage,” said Mesdag, who thinks iRobot would be a great acquisition for one of the Big Three. “The competition is focused on making cleaning products, not a mapping robot.”

Military beginnings

Founded in 1990, iRobot saw early success building bomb disposal robots for the U.S. Army before launching the world’s first “robovac” in 2002. The company sold off its military unit last year to focus on the consumer sector, and says the Roomba — which ranges in price from $375 to $899 — still has 88 percent of the U.S. robovac market.

All robovacs use short-range infrared or laser sensors to detect and avoid obstacles, but iRobot in 2015 added a camera, new sensors and software to its flagship 900-series Roomba that gave it the ability to build a map while keeping track of its own location within that map.

So-called simultaneous localization and mapping (SLAM) technology right now enables Roomba, and other higher-end robovacs made by Dyson and other rivals, to do things like stop vacuuming, head back to its dock to recharge and then return to the same spot to finish the job.

Guy Hoffman, a robotics professor at Cornell University, said detailed spatial mapping technology would be a “major breakthrough” for the smart home.

Right now, smart home devices operate “like a tourist in New York who never leaves the subway,” said Hoffman. “There is some information about the city, but the tourist is missing a lot of context for what’s happening outside of the stations.”

With regularly updated maps, Hoffman said, sound systems could match home acoustics, air conditioners could schedule airflow by room, and smart lighting could adjust according to the position of windows and time of day.

Companies like Amazon, Google and Apple could also use the data to recommend home goods for customers to buy, said Hoffman.

Privacy concerns

One potential downside is that sharing data about users’ homes raises clear privacy issues, said Ben Rose, an analyst who covers iRobot for Battle Road Research. Customers could find it “sort of a scary thing,” he said.

Angle said iRobot would not be sharing data without its customers’ permission, but he expressed confidence most would give their consent in order to access the smart home functions.

Another Roomba risk is that cheaper cleaning products are what consumers really want. In May, The New York Times’ Sweethome blog dethroned the $375 Roomba 690 as its most-recommended robovac in favor of the $220 Eufy RoboVac 11, saying the connectivity and other advanced features of the former would not justify the greater cost for most users.

Short-seller Axler’s June report caused a stir mostly with its prediction that value-priced appliance maker SharkNinja Operating LLC could launch a robovac by year’s end. SharkNinja declined to comment.

One potential iRobot bulwark against these new competitors: a portfolio of 1,000 patents worldwide covering the very concept of a self-navigating household robot vacuum as well as basic technologies like object avoidance.

A handful of those patents are now being tested in a series of patent infringement lawsuits iRobot filed in April against Bissell, Stanley Black & Decker, Hoover Inc., Chinese outsourced manufacturers and other robovac makers. The litigation is the most significant in iRobot’s history.

A lawyer for Hoover declined to comment. Lawyers for Bissell and Stanley Black & Decker did not respond to requests for comment.

The patents are a “huge part of our competitive moat,” Angle said. “It is getting really hard not to step on our intellectual property.”

YouTube-inspired New Toys Aim to Wow Today’s Digitally Savvy Kids

For some youngsters, “unboxing” YouTube videos are all the rage. They involve a pair of hands – some small, some big with lacquered nails or others with hairy knuckles — unwrapping and playing with new toys.

The concept looks and feels mundane, but some of these videos have clocked hundreds of millions of views.

Now this YouTube sensation is influencing the toy industry.

‘Blind bag’ items

Toymakers are creating “blind bag” items, small inexpensive toys packaged in opaque plastic bags. Kids can’t see what they’re getting until the package is opened.

An antidote to digital childhoods, where every song or video is a click away? Maybe.

“Blind bags right now are huge. Kids love opening them, love the surprise factor,” Kelly Foley, marketing manager at Wicked Cool Toys, said.

These blind bag items as well as blind bag miniature collectible sets were on display in New York City recently, at the “Sweet Suite” toy event hosted by The Toy Insider, an online toy review guide.

Foley was showing off the “Little Sprouts” collection from Cabbage Patch Kids. The miniature figurines (more than 120 in all) come in “blind” cabbages, and are meant to be collected.

“They’re small, they’re able to be purchased with allowance money or money that kids earn, pocket change,” Jackie Breyer, editor-in-chief at The Toy Insider, said. A Little Sprouts blind cabbage retails for $2.99.

Influence on toy culture

YouTube’s influence on the toy culture can also be seen in another hot toy – the fidget spinner craze.

“They’re seeing their peers do really cool tricks and also they’re collecting,” Breyer said. “They want a full collection of these, they don’t just want one.”

Besides paying attention to YouTube, toymakers are moving quickly to speak the language of today’s digital natives with toys like the Elmoji, a robot that teaches children coding basics using emojis. It is made by Sesame Street and WowWee.

“It’s a visual language that kids get intuitively, and we want to have them solve problems using emojis because they’re comfortable with them,” Natalie Wight, art director at WowWee, said.

The Lego Boost teaches basic coding principles to kids as young as 7.

But it’s not all work and no play.

“You can build a robot and make him do things like turn and hit a target,” Amanda Madore, senior brand relations manager at LEGO, said. “Or pull his finger and make him pass gas, which kids love.”

Now that might get some views on YouTube.

After all, tech trends may come and go, but kids will still be kids.
